We are very excited about our 14' x 14' cedar log cabin! The trees were carefully selected from Glenaura and Glen Osprey, cut and milled then designed and built by our very own Chris Pease - so you can imagine how special this building is.
Being that the Fall of 2018 is it's maiden season, we still have some finishing touches to complete but it has had it's first official guests and has lots to offer being situated in the lee of mature trees with a full panorama of Glenaura's 100 acres.
With just over 20 km between us and the beautiful Dufferin County Forest Main Tract, we invite you to plan a weekend of horse time with your favourite people and rest comfortably here with your horses after trailering back from a long day on the trails, after all - horse care is what we do! Don't forget we have a wonderful Mountain Trail Horse Park to play in and a huge amount of clinics throughout the year, speaking of which - stay tuned for some exciting events next year, we plan to offer some amazing "Glenaura Getaways" for horse and rider (or non rider!)
What your stay includes:
* Accommodations for 6 with two single bunk beds, one queen bed and a loft that would comfortably fit 2 or more adults. Air
mattresses provided but please bring your own bedding and pillows, and remember there is no heat so pack accordingly!
* Solar/battery operated lights (sorry, no hydro service but you are welcome to bring a generator!)
* Outhouse facilities
* Picnic table outside and a small table and comfortable lounge chairs inside
* Two 10' x 10' portable steel stalls that can be set up in the shade beside the cabin, this can also be configured to one 20' x 20' pen
*. Cell phone charging area and access to hydro for coffee etc in our indoor arena
$85/night
For an additional fee:
* 1/2 acre electric braid fence paddock
* 10' x 12' straw bedded stall in our barn (only available May - September)
* Continental style breakfast delivered from the main house
* Access to our indoor arena and Mountain Trail Horse Park
* Ample trailer parking
Cost TBD
